Searched defs:ArrayVec (Results 1 – 2 of 2) sorted by relevance
| /external/rust/crates/tinyvec/src/ |
| D | arrayvec.rs | 104 pub struct ArrayVec<A> { struct 109 impl<A> Clone for ArrayVec<A> implementation 139 impl<A> Copy for ArrayVec<A> implementation 146 impl<A: Array> Default for ArrayVec<A> { implementation 152 impl<A: Array> Deref for ArrayVec<A> { implementation 161 impl<A: Array> DerefMut for ArrayVec<A> { implementation 169 impl<A: Array, I: SliceIndex<[A::Item]>> Index<I> for ArrayVec<A> { implementation 178 impl<A: Array, I: SliceIndex<[A::Item]>> IndexMut<I> for ArrayVec<A> { implementation 188 impl<A: Array> Serialize for ArrayVec<A> implementation 207 impl<'de, A: Array> Deserialize<'de> for ArrayVec<A> implementation [all …]
|
| /external/rust/crates/der/src/ |
| D | arrayvec.rs | 9 pub(crate) struct ArrayVec<T, const N: usize> { struct 17 impl<T, const N: usize> ArrayVec<T, N> { argument 75 impl<T, const N: usize> AsRef<[Option<T>]> for ArrayVec<T, N> { implementation 81 impl<T, const N: usize> AsMut<[Option<T>]> for ArrayVec<T, N> { implementation 87 impl<T, const N: usize> Default for ArrayVec<T, N> { implementation
|